So when you turn down an existing offer and tell the company youre going elsewhere, dont say, This other company offers amazing perks, and the team sounds wonderful, and I really like all of the job duties, and they provide more benefits, too. While that may seem like youre providing useful feedback to this potential employer, its usually just going to be received negatively.
